Canada finally claimed their space atop the world of basketball, completing a magical run in Cairo with a 79-60 victory over Italy to capture their first-ever FIBA U19 Basketball World Cup title.
Canada’s star young prospect RJ Barrett once again led the way - as he has all tournament - with team highs of 18 points and 10 rebounds to go with four assists while Abu Kigab chipped in 12 points, 10 rebounds and two assists.
Barrett, who was two years younger than the rest of the competition, ended up as the tournament’s leading scorer at 21.6 points a game and took home the MVP Award offered by Tissot with Kigab joining him on the All-Star Five.
The Canadians of course were thrilled to win the title but the Italians were also satisfied to have even reached their first U19 final since 1991.
